The High Cost of Medications and the Need for Help

When a singular parent was diagnosed with leukemia, he discovered his ordered prescription would cost a monthly sum exceeding $16,000.
Even when insured, deductibles and copays were significant.
With urgency for relief, he approached Rx Help Centers—and shortly secured his life-preserving drug at zero expense.

Tales of similar nature are becoming prevalent in the modern healthcare environment.
Approximately roughly one in three of U.S. adults have stated they omit doses or do not fill prescriptions because of cost.
Skyrocketing prices, especially for new specialty drugs, have left many patients and families in crisis.
Such expenses burden finances and undermine health; when individuals cannot pay for their medications, they frequently omit treatment, resulting in deteriorated outcomes and heightened long-term charges.

Both individuals and healthcare professionals realize this expanding problem.
Medical practitioners note that patients often modify their treatment protocols, as employers perceive the strain of high drug expenses on their benefit plans.
The urgent question is: How can we bridge the gap between patients and the medications they need?
One compelling solution is found in prescription assistance programs and advocacy services such as Rx Help Centers.
They function as facilitators and deal-makers, guiding patients to secure medications for a minimal fee or free via different assistance programs.
With ballooning drug prices and expanding insurance deficits, prescription support has shifted from a limited service into an key support system.

An Overview of Rx Help Centers’ Functionality and Service Offerings

Rx Help Centers adopts a sequential process engineered to reduce high medication costs.

An outline of their common process and service offerings is provided below.

Free Medication Cost Examination
The procedure starts with a free assessment of the patient’s medication inventory and associated costs.

Anyone can submit their prescriptions and financial details for review, and the team will identify potential savings.
This first consultation is completely free, and no fee is incurred unless it is evident that the patient will achieve greater savings than their current expenditure.

Joining Available Aid Programs
Once savings opportunities are pinpointed, Rx Help Centers’ advocates take charge of enrollment and administrative tasks for the suitable programs.
Programs can involve manufacturer patient assistance programs (PAPs) providing complimentary or discounted brand-name medications, charitable foundations offering copay assistance, and other available resources.
By accessing a diverse selection of available resources—frequently amounting to hundreds—the team uncovers help for medications that may not have a clear discount option.
Every medication is assigned to the most fitting available support, and the team administers all needed applications, doctor’s sign-offs, income documentation, plus other required actions for the patient.

Medicine Advocacy and Coordination
The service also coordinates directly with physicians, pharmacies, and insurance companies when needed.
For example, when a manufacturer program stipulates a doctor’s sign-off or prescription, Rx Help Centers coordinates with the physician to get the necessary paperwork.
They ensure that drugs are transported to the patient’s home, clinic, or local pharmacy in compliance with the program's rules.
Throughout the entire procedure, advocates ensure that the patient is kept informed via regular phone or email updates, maintaining a clear line of communication about application progress and refills.

Fixed-Rate Membership Model

If a patient chooses to proceed with Rx Help Centers after the free analysis, the service imposes a fixed monthly fee for boundless support.
Near $60 each month, this fee remains the same independent of the number or expense of drugs.
Crucially, this fixed-fee structure does not deduct a share of the savings—a method prevalent among other companies.
In lieu of commissions or kickbacks, Rx Help Centers operates without external incentives, so its advocates remain solely dedicated to maximizing patient savings.
The organization verifies that enrollment is undertaken solely when the forecasted savings notably eclipse the monthly fee, ensuring that patients gain financially.

Current Trends in the Industry and the Overall Healthcare Landscape
Rx Help Centers’ inception is a component of an expansive movement aimed at mitigating the challenge of medication affordability.
Across the nation, the expansion of prescription assistance programs has been driven by the rising costs of healthcare.
Almost every leading pharmaceutical company currently provides some type of aid for expensive brand-name drugs.
with a large network of nonprofit groups and government subsidies working to fill the void.
Nonetheless, the sheer volume of programs, each with its own distinct process and criteria, means that numerous eligible patients never benefit from the available assistance.

One of the most significant trends in this industry is the growing role of alternative funding programs within employer health plans.
Given the escalating cost of specialty medications, numerous self-funded employers are exploring novel approaches to manage the financial burden.
By collaborating with prescription advocacy services, employers can identify expensive claims and reallocate those costs to external funding programs, thus reducing total expenditures.
This dual approach enhances both the financial health of the organization and the health outcomes of employees by ensuring access to essential medications.

An emerging trend in the industry is the incorporation of technology and data analytics into the prescription support process.
Certain systems can now align patients with suitable aid programs through electronic health record indicators or pharmacy software, which streamlines the process.
Although Rx Help Centers relies on a human-driven method today, prospects for digital integration may further optimize efficiency and accuracy.

Legislative and policy modifications continuously mold the landscape of prescription aid.
Recent legislative measures, such as drug price caps for certain medications, offer some relief, particularly for seniors on Medicare.
Yet millions of patients, particularly individuals under 65 or those receiving treatments excluded from these caps, continue to confront unaffordable costs.
Consequently, the demand for this contact form all-encompassing assistance programs is more urgent than ever.
Charitable organizations and nonprofits are extending their programs to cover more patients, while hospitals are increasingly integrating prescription assistance into discharge planning to curb readmissions.
